Georgia’s Time Limit


Per state civil code, you typically have 24 months from the date of the accident to submit a legal action. Missing this deadline can bar your right to collect compensation, no matter how obvious the other driver’s fault. Can I still file a claim if the accident was partially my fault in a Druid Hills bike accident?


Yes—you may still obtain damages even if you were somewhat at fault due to Georgia’s modified comparative negligence rule. As long as your degree of fault is less than 50%, you can claim recovery.

How much does it cost to hire a motorcyclist injury advocate in DeKalb County?


Most personal injury attorney firms operate on a performance-based basis, meaning you avoid out-of-pocket fees. The legal percentage is only taken if you secure an insurance settlement.

Typical success charges range from approximately one-third of the final award, and many offer a zero-fee assessment to explore your case.
